Since the publication of ISO 21500, companies can be aware of the processes that can be applied for effectively managing the projects they carry out. However, guidance for assessing and improving these project management processes is not provided. The Project Management SPICE (PMSPICE) Framework will provide a process assessment and improvement model in the project management domain. This paper details how the requirements of ISO 21500 were transformed to develop the PMSPICE Process Reference Model (PRM), which is compliant with the requirements of ISO/IEC 33004. Based upon the PMSPICE PRM, a process assessment model will be build.
